Who Was BiBi Masuma e Qum?

BiBi Masuma e Qum, also known as Fatima Masuma, was the daughter of the 7th Imam, Imam Musa al-Kadhim, and the sister of the 8th Imam, Imam Ali al-Ridha. She was a pious and devoted follower of the Ahlul Bayt, known for her piety, wisdom, and devotion to Islam. BiBi Masuma e Qum is buried in the holy city of Qom, Iran, where her shrine is visited by millions of pilgrims every year.

Why Is Cleanliness Important in Islam?

Cleanliness holds a special place in Islam, as it is considered to be half of faith. The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him) emphasized the importance of cleanliness in numerous hadiths, stating that cleanliness is a part of faith and that cleanliness leads to faith. Keeping oneself clean and pure is not only a sign of respect for oneself, but also a reflection of one’s faith and devotion to Allah.
